Barter News thanks Ron Whitney, Executive Director of the International Reciprocal Trade Association, for the following summation of the IRTA Convention.

Constantinides, Rosinski & Riggs Receive Top Honors At IRTA Convention

Thirty-four-year veteran of the barter industry, Perry Constantinides � founder of Barter Systems in Kensington (MD) � was inducted into the Barter Hall of Fame at the International Reciprocal Trade Association�s 32nd International Convention last month.

Perry�s accomplishments in the barter industry are well documented, he helped form IRTA in 1979, he was instrumental in getting TEFRA passed in 1982, he has served on countless IRTA committees including the recent CTB Revision Committee, Ethics Committee and UC Committee. He is currently serving his second term as IRTA�s Vice President. (The entire IRTA family congratulates Perry on his much deserved award!)

Another long-time contributor to the barter industry recognized at the IRTA Convention was Sylvia M. Rosinski � founder of Tradesource in Phoenix (AZ) � who received the prestigious Paul St. Martin Award for over three decades of outstanding service to the barter industry. IRTA Board Member and Treasurer Mary Ellen Rosinski accepted the award on behalf of her mother. (IRTA also congratulates Sylvia and thanks her for her outstanding contributions to IRTA and the barter industry.)

Annette Riggs from Community Connect Trade in Denver (CO), received the first ever David Wallach Outstanding Achievement Award for her selfless and endless contributions to IRTA and the barter industry. (IRTA thanks Annette for her energy and wisdom, and recognizes that without her contributions IRTA would not have been able to accomplish the goals it has in the last few years.)

Terry Brandfass from Trade Management Consulting in Phoenix (AZ), received the IRTA Executive Director Award, for her tireless work for IRTA including the help she regularly provides to IRTA�s Executive Director Ron Whitney.

The following additional individuals received much deserved Certificates of Appreciation for their fine efforts on behalf of IRTA:

         Patty Weston, Universal Currency (UC) international broker,

         Scott Whitmer, owner of Florida Barter & UC Committee chairman,

         Mike Mercier, owner of Metro Trade & IRTA president,

         Kim Strabley of IMS, a UC Committee member & CTB chairman,

         Carl Steinbrenner, Esq, IRTA�s legal counsel, and

         Harold Rice, owner of American Exchange Network & chairman of the IRTA Membership Committee.

IRTA wishes to thank the award winners for their service to the association as well as to the modern trade and barter industry!
